Warren G. Magnuson Park is located near a mile-long stretch of Lake Washington’s shoreline in northeastern Seattle. At 350 acres, it is Seattle’s second largest park. This former Navy facility is rapidly becoming home to a unique combination of features and activities for you to enjoy: recreation and leisure—boating, swimming, walks, kite flying, to name a few; sports fields; natural areas; and a community campus. The Park offers you ample opportunity to explore a range of natural areas. There are grasslands, wooded hillsides, wetlands and shoreline within the park's boundaries. Community volunteers have actively been restoring habitat areas in the park for many years.
